  • In this paper, we conducted experimental investigation on the field applicability through the verification of reinforcement effect of the steel pipe reinforcement grouting using high strength steel pipe. SGT275 (formerly known as STK400) steel pipe is generally applied to the traditional steel pipe reinforcement grouting method. However, the analysis of tunnel collapse cases applying the steel pipe reinforcement grouting shows that there are cases where the excessive bending and breakage of steel pipe occur. One of the reasons causing these collapses is the lack of steel pipe stiffness responding to the loosening load of tunnels caused by excavation. The strength of steel pipe has increased due to the recent development of high strength steel pipe (SGT550). However, since research on the reinforcement method considering strength increase is insufficient, there is a need for research on this. Therefore, in this study, we conducted experiments on the tensile and bending strength based on various conditions between high strength steel pipe, and carried out basic research on effective field application depending on the strength difference of steel pipe through the conventional design method. In particular, we verified the reinforcement effect of high strength steel pipe through the measurement results of deformed shape and stress of steel pipe arising from excavation after constructing high strength steel pipe and general steel pipe at actual sites. The research results show that high strength steel pipe has excellent bending strength and the reinforcement effect of reinforced grouting. Further, it is expected that high strength steel pipe will have an arching effect thanks to strength increase.

  • This study investigated the ground displacement occurring in a slope below a waste-rock dumping site and estimated the likelihood of a disaster due to a landslide. To start with, photogrammetry was conducted by un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) to investigate the size and extent of the ground displacement. From April 2019 to July 2020, the average error rate of the five UAV surveys was 0.011-0.034 m, and an elevation change of 2.97 m occurred due to the movement of the soil layer. Only some areas of the slope showedelevation change, and this was believed to be due to thegroundwater generated during rainfall rather than the effect of the waste-rock load at the top. Sensitivity analysis for LS-RAPID simulation was performed, and the simulation results were compared and analyzed by applying a digital elevation model (DEM) and a digital surface model (DSM)as terrain data with 10 m, 5 m, and 4 m grids. When data with high spatial resolution were used, the extent of the sedimentation of landslide material tended to be excessively expanded in the DEM. In contrast, in the result of applying a DSM, which reflects the topography in detail, the diffusion range was not significantly affected even when the spatial resolution was changed, and the sedimentation behavior according to the river shape could be accurately expressed. As a result, it was concluded that applying a DSM rather than a DEM does not significantly expand the sedimentation range, and results that reflect the site situation well can be obtained.

  • Welded head studs are mainly used as shear connectors to bond steel girders and concrete slabs in steel-concrete composite bridges. For welded shear connectors, environmental problems include noise and scattering dust which are generated during the removal of damaged or aged slabs. Therefore, it is necessary to develop demountable shear connectors that can easily replace aged concrete slabs for efficient maintenance and thus for better management of environmental problems and life cycle costs. The buried nut method is commonly studied in relation to bolted shear connectors, but this method is not used in civil structures such as bridges due to low rigidity, low shear resistance, and increased initial slip. In this study, in order to mitigate these problems, a demountable bolted shear connector is proposed in which the buried nut is integrated into the stud column and has a tapered shape at the bottom of an enlarged column shank. To verify the performance of the proposed demountable stud bolts in terms of static shear strength and slip displacement, a horizontal shear test was conducted, with the performance outcomes compared to those of conventional welded studs. It was confirmed that the proposed demountable bolted shear connector is capable of excellent shear performance and that it satisfies the slip displacement and ductility design criteria, meaning that it is feasible as a replacement for existing welding studs.

  • In order to develop SFRC TBM tunnel segment, evaluating the SFRC mixture was conducted through flexural tests of SFRC beams without ordinary steel reinforcement in this study. Considered variables were compressive strengths of SFRC, aspect and mix ratio of steel fibers and total 16 specimens were fabricated and tested until failure. The load-vertical displacement results demonstrates that the effect of aspect ratio is minor when compared to results form small beam test(Moon et al, 2013). A SFRC beam resists the vertical load until the width of crack reaches to 7 mm due to steel fibers across cracked surfaces. Moreover, it is found that flexural moment estimated by equation of TR No. 63(Concrete Society, 2011) is useful for prediction of nominal strength for SFRC structure. From the investigation of fiber distribution in cracked section, it is found that dispersion improved in actual size beam compared to in standard small beam for evaluation of flexural strength.

  • The purpose of this study is to establish a reasonable analytical method for the estimation of overall behavior characteristic from cracking to yielding of rebar and crushing of concrete and seismic performance of reinforced concrete shear wall with high-strength reinforcing bar. A total of 8 specimens of reinforced concrete walls which have constant aspect ratio and a variety of variables such as reinforcement ratio, reinforcement yielding strength, reinforcement details, concrete design strength, section shape and whether lateral restraint hoop were selected and the analysis was performed by using a non-linear finite element analysis program (RCAHEST) applying the proposed constitutive equation by the authors. The mean and coefficient of variation for maximum load from the experiment and analysis results was predicted 1.04 and 8%. The mean and coefficient of variation for displacement corresponding maximum load from the experiment and analysis results was predicted 1.17 and 19% respectively. The analytical results were predicted relatively well the fracture mode and the overall behavior until fracture for all specimens. These results are expected to be used as basic data for application of high-strength reinforcing bar to design codes in the future.

  • An analysis method is proposed for the transient linear or nonlinear analysis of dynamic interactions between a flexible dam body and reservoir impounding compressible water under earthquake loadings. The coupled dam-reservoir system consists of three substructures: (1) a dam body with linear or nonlinear behavior; (2) a semi-infinite fluid region with constant depth; and (3) an irregular fluid region between the dam body and far field. The dam body is modeled with linear and/or nonlinear finite elements. The far field is formulated as a displacement-based transmitting boundary in the frequency domain that can radiate energy into infinity. Then the transmitting boundary is transformed for the direct coupling in the time domain. The near field region is modeled as a compressible fluid contained between two substructures. The developed method is verified and applied to various earthquake response analyses of dam-reservoir systems. Also, the method is applied to a nonlinear analysis of a concrete gravity dam. The results show the location and severity of damage demonstrating the applicability to the seismic evaluation of existing and new dams.

  • 현재 국내에서 시행되고 있는 '4대강 살리기 사업'은 하천에서 발생하는 홍수 및 가뭄재해방지를 위한 다양한 공학적 노력을 시도하고 있다. 특히 안정적인 수위 및 유량확보와 홍수방지를 위한 보(weir)가 4대강 유역에 16개 설치되고 있다. 이러한 보 구간에는 고정보와 가동보가 복합적으로 설치되고 있으며 가동보는 그 형상과 운영방식에 따라 다양한 설계방안이 적용되었다. '4대강 살리기 사업' 중 낙동강 23공구의 강정보 공사 구간에는 원호형태의 측면 형상을 갖는 라이징 섹터게이트(Rising sector gate)가 적용되었다. 라이징 섹터게이트는 구조물의 높이가 낮고 수문의 개폐장치가 수문피어 구조물 내에 설치되어 경관이 우수하며, 구조가 간단하여 비체와 수류의 안정성이 뛰어나기 때문에 4개의 공사구간에 적용되었다. 따라서 본 연구에서는 강정보의 가동보 구간 2문 중 1문을 1/100 축척으로 제작하여 가변경사 개수로에 설치하고, 홍수 빈도별 상류 유량 조건과 하류단 수위조건으로 케이스를 정하여 실험을 수행하였다. 본 실험에서 사용한 개수로 장치는 너비 0.6 m, 높이 0.8 m, 그리고 길이 15.0 m(측정가능 구간, 헤드탱크와 테일게이트 부제외)의 개수로 실험장치이다. 측부는 모두 강화유리로 되어 육안관찰 및 계측 시 용이하게 제작되었으며, 순환식 유량 공급장치를 구축하여 수로의 하부에 설치된 유량탱크로부터 계속적으로 순환하도록 설계되었다. 또한 수로 하단으로부터 상단방향으로 약 33 m 지점에 전동 유압식 Jack screw 2기가 설치되어 경사도를 조절할 수 있도록 제작되었다. 유량조절용 판넬의 제어기판에는 디지털 경사계가 설치되어 있기 때문에 보다 정확한 경사도의 조절이 가능하다. 보 모형의 총연장은 53 cm이며 폭은 45 cm이다. 섹터게이트의 게이트부분은 직경 15 cm로 설계하였다. 문주부분을 포함한 모든 모형은 아크릴로 제작하며 레이저의 주사를 방해하지 않으며 투과율을 최대로 할 수 있도록 고강도의 아크릴을 가장 얇게 하여 중공형태를 채택하였다. 실험조건은 우선 보의 운영방안에 따라 게이트의 4가지 개방도를 설정하였고, 특히 평수위조건에서는 보의 상류부에 퇴적된 퇴적물의 세척을 위한 flushing 운영개방도 포함되어 있다. 홍수시에 대한 유량조건은 2년 빈도에 해당하는 유량을 수문의 비율과 상사법칙에 따라 설정하였으며 하류단 수위조건도 동일한 조건에 대한 값을 채택하여 적용하였다. 유동장의 해석을 위해서는 비접촉식 계측방법인 PIV(Particle Image Velocimetry) 시스템을 채택하여 2차원(x-z 방향) laser sheet를 생성하고 주입된 particle에서 반사된 변위(displacement) 정보를 상호상관(cross-correlation)기법으로 유동장을 계산하였다. 또한 수리모형과 동일한 지형격자를 구축하여 3차원 CFD 프로그램인 FLOW-3D로 계산하여 결과를 비교하였다. 특히 flushing 운영방안에 대한 게이트부의 개방도를 세가지(30, 45, $60^{\circ}$)로 구분하여 모의하였고, 적절한 개방도를 제안하고자 하였다. 실험결과는 우선 4가지 운영방안에 대한 가동보 주변에서의 유속장을 파악하였고, 최대유속의 발생위치의 변화를 확인할 수 있었다. 그리고 이에 따른 보의 바닥에서 최대유속이 발생할 경우, 하상보호공 위치와 거리 등에 대해서 분석하였다. 이를 통해 가동보 운영에 따른 다양한 유속구조를 파악할 수 있게 되며 구조적 안정성 확보를 위한 검증자료로 활용될 수 있을 것으로 예상된다. 향후, 가동보 운영방안 중 수세효과(flushing effect)에 대한 효과분석을 위해 게이트부 상류구간에 적절한 입경과 비중의 퇴적물질을 설치하는 연구와 상류부에서의 유입유사농도 및 시간변화에 따른 퇴적에 관한 연구를 수행할 계획이다.

  • Many study have been performed to describe the elastic and inelastic behavior of H-shaped beams with web openings that generally concentrated on the monotonic loading condition and concentric web opening. The findings of the studies led Darwin to propose formulas for the design of beams with web openings considering local buckling. While the formulas are simple and useful in real situation, more studies arc needed on their cyclic loading condition. In this experimental study, 12 H-shaped beams with web openings under cyclic loading condition were investigated. The dimension criteria based on the formulas proposed by Darwin were examined. The suitability of existing design formulas and the effects of plastic hinges on beams with web openings and of local buckling around web openings on the beam strength under cyclic loading were also studied. This was done by observing their behavior with various dimensional openings, eccentric per cent, and stiffeners.

  • A three dimensional (3-D) method of analysis is presented for determining the free vibration frequencies and mode shapes of deep, tapered rods and beams with circular cross section. Unlike conventional rod and beam theories, which are mathematically one-dimensional (1-D), the present method is based upon the 3-D dynamic equations of elasticity. Displacement components u/sup r/, u/sub θ/ and u/sub z/, in the radial, circumferential, and axial directions, respectively, are taken to be sinusoidal in time, periodic in , and algebraic polynomials in the r and z directions. Potential (strain) and kinetic energies of the rods and beams are formulated, the Ritz method is used to solve the eigenvalue problem, thus yielding upper bound values of the frequencies by minimizing the frequencies. As the degree of the polynomials is increased, frequencies converge to the exact values. Convergence to four-digit exactitude is demonstrated for the first five frequencies of the rods and beams. Novel numerical results are tabulated for nine different tapered rods and beams with linear, quadratic, and cubic variations of radial thickness in the axial direction using the 3D theory. Comparisons are also made with results for linearly tapered beams from 1-D classical Euler-Bernoulli beam theory.

  • This study investigated the characteristics of bifurcation and the instability due to the initial imperfection of the space truss, which is sensitive to the initial conditions, and the calculated buckling load by the analysis of Eigen-values and the determinant of tangential stiffness. A two-free nodes model, a star dome, and a three-ring dome model were selected as case studies in order to examine the unstable phenomenon due to the sensitivity to Eigen mode, and the influence of the rise-span ratio and the load parameter on the buckling load were analyzed. The sensitivity to the imperfection of the two-free nodes model changed the critical path after reaching the limit point through the bifurcation mode, and the buckling load level was reduced by the increase in the amount of imperfection. The two sensitive buckling patterns for the model can be explained by investigating the displaced position of the free node, and the asymmetric Eigen mode was a major influence on the unstable behavior due to the initial imperfection. The sensitive mode was similar to the in-extensional mechanism basis of the simplified model. Since the rise-span ratio was higher, the effect of local buckling is more prominent than the global buckling in the star dome, and bifurcation on the equilibrium path occurring as the value of the load parameter was higher. Additionally, the buckling load levels of the star dome and the three-ring model were about 50-70% and 80-90% of the limit point, respectively.
